Round boards are durable, circular supports specifically designed for holding cakes, enhancing presentation and stability while serving as a decorative backdrop for special occasions. Ideal for single-use or occasional events, they contribute to an elegant table setting and facilitate easy serving. In the United States, these boards have become increasingly popular among home bakers and professional pastry chefs alike, driven by a growing trend in baking and celebratory events that prioritize both functionality and aesthetics. Today's shoppers seek a mix of reliable load-bearing performance, attractive finishes such as silver or gold, food-safe materials, and sizes that match standard cake tiers from 6 to 14 inches. Consumers also value options that are easy to store, cost efficient for frequent entertaining, and environmentally sensitive when possible. Whether you are assembling a layered wedding cake, a birthday centerpiece, or a small gathering dessert, the right round board improves stability during transport, speeds serving, and elevates the finished look for photographs and display tables.

Why Board Material, Stiffness, and Food Safety Matter
Selecting the right round cake board relies on basic material science and food safety principles. Boards made from food-grade cardboard with moisture-resistant coatings or thin aluminum provide a nonporous surface that reduces the risk of contamination and resists warping under typical cake weight. Higher stiffness reduces deflection, which keeps layered cakes level and prevents frosting damage. Non-slip finishes or textured undersides help keep cakes steady during transport. Regulatory guidance for food contact materials, along with food-safety research on nonporous surfaces, supports choosing coated, smooth boards for direct cake contact when possible. For display-only or decorative use, metallic-laminated or debossed finishes add visual appeal without compromising structural performance when boards are matched to cake size and weight.
Food-contact guidance from agencies such as the FDA recommends using food-grade, nonporous surfaces for items that touch finished foods.
Studies on surface hygiene show that smooth, coated surfaces retain fewer microbes than porous materials, making coated boards preferable for direct cake contact.
Basic structural engineering shows increased board thickness and stiffer materials reduce bending under load, preventing sagging for multi-tier cakes.
Non-slip treatments and edge lip designs reduce lateral movement during transport, lowering the chance of sliding or frosting damage.
Sustainability trends and lifecycle assessments are driving interest in recyclable and compostable coated boards for single-use occasions.
